chain objtFeInv [T always + adv/prep]用链条拴住,拘禁,束缚It's so cruel to keep a pony chained up like that all the time.把一匹马驹一直那样拴住真是太残酷了。They chained themselves to lampposts in protest at the judge's decision.他们为了抗议法官的判决把自己拴在灯柱上。(fig.) I don't want a job where I'm chained to (=limited to working at) a desk for eight hours a day.我不想要一份得一天八小时守在办公桌前的工作。
